A great combination of mental and physical activity for all ages, juggling is athletic as well as artistic, and can be done individually or in a group.  Learning to juggle will improve your:


  hand-eye coordination

  focus & concentration

  self-confidence

  artistic performance

  teamwork & cooperation

  sense of rhythm

  body awareness & control

  of movement

  stamina & physical fitness

  discipline through practice



The process of learning to juggle, of looking at a pattern to see what isn't working and then figuring out how to fix it, can only improve your problem-solving skills.  Transferring that information from your brain to your body is intense, sometimes frustrating exercise, but so delightfully satisfying when accomplished!  Once mastered, juggling can actually become a calming and meditative tool that can serve as a great break in the daily routine, allowing one to return to work or study feeling refreshed and more productive.
